​Once I filled out the application on the Dogs Matter website, I got a call back very promptly. I was literally in a time crunch to find someone or some place to take care of my dogs while I was at treatment. They found a foster family that would take both of my dogs and not separate them. I was afraid that a foster family wouldn’t take two dogs at a hundred pounds a piece. But they pulled it off!

My dogs were well loved and taken care of, which gave me a huge sense of relief while focusing on my extended time in treatment and recovery. Throughout my 6 months in care, I was sent stays updates with pictures through my counselor. Even when I wasn’t always available, they continued to reach out and motivate me to get better and get my dogs back!

Dogs Matter continues to follow up with me and to be there for support even after my treatment. They have helped me with food, dog supplies, vet care, and coaching me as I get back up on my feet.

No words can ever fully express how very grateful I am to Stephen and Taylor. These guys really do care!
